Gear Review: Livingston JerkMaster 121D

What is it?

Livingston Lures JerkMaster 121D

What does it do?

Deep-diving suspending jerkbait featuring Electronic Baitfish Sound (EBS)

What sets it apart?

Livingston set a new standard with their patented EBS emitting lures after Randy Howell won the 2014 Bassmaster Classic on Lake Guntersville. The same technology has been made available in a complete line of Livingston Lures, recently the JerkMaster 121, but now the same enticing darting action and weight and balance system is available in a deep-diving model that reaches depths of around 10 feet.

How do I use it?

The 121D is perfect for casting around offshore structure and even trolling applications. The sound is emitted automatically when it comes in contact with water. The lure is 4 3/4 inches long, weighs 3/4 ounce and is available in seven forage-matching colors.
